ZSimpWin Tutorial: A Complete Guide to EIS Data Fitting ZSimpWin is a robust Windows-based application designed for the modeling and analysis of Electrochemical Impedance Spectroscopy (EIS) data. It is widely used by researchers to interpret impedance measurements for systems like batteries, fuel cells, and corrosion coatings by fitting raw data to an equivalent circuit model (ECM).
